| Summary: | FeCoNi(CuAl)0.2 high entropy alloy (HEA) thin films were produced by magnetron sputtering. Results from X-ray diffractometry analysis, scanning electron microscopy, energy dispersive spectroscopy, and atomic force microscope indicate the formation of a single face-centered cubic solid solution with a homogenous distribution of alloying elements in the film according to the designed composition after 30 min of sputtering. The vibrant sample magnetometer test illustrated soft magnetic behavior with 139.67 emu/g magnetic saturation (MS) and 7.96 Oe coercivity field (Hc) in a 2 T applied magnetic field with excellent hardness 136.8 GPa and Young’s modulus 7.33 GPa. The formation of micro-nano columnar crystals led to a higher MS and lower Hc. |
